    Man hired former stewardess for shelling crabs

    A woman helps a man eat cooked crab at a seafood restaurant in Hangzhou, east China’s Zhejiang province on Aug 28, 2015. The woman, 27, is a retired airline stewardess and known online for her crab-eating skills, such as separating the legs and claws to get meat. She offers the service on Taobao.com, China’s largest e-commerce site, and charges 10 yuan ($1.6) to prepare crab meat and five yuan extra to help with eating. The man spent 260 yuan on the service. After the meal, the man comments her service online. (Photo/gmw.cn)
